The modding scene for Fire Emblem: Three Houses is vibrant, particularly on emulators which allow for easy mod management. Modders have created a wide variety of content, from simple cosmetic mods, like allowing the player to run at 60 FPS instead of the standard 30, to complete gameplay overhauls and randomizers that change how the game is played.
